Michigan OC Chip Lindsey Discusses Wolverines' Offense and QB Battle

Michigan's offensive coordinator, Chip Lindsey, recently spoke about the Wolverines' offensive preparations for the 2025 season, highlighting the ongoing quarterback battle and the team's overall progress during fall camp.

Key Insights

Quarterback Competition:: The QB battle includes Bryce Underwood, Mikey Keene, Jadyn Davis, and newcomer Jake Garcia. Lindsey emphasizes evaluating QBs in various situational football scenarios.

Wide Receiver Improvement:: Lindsey stresses the need for WRs to step up, supported by improvements across other positions to alleviate pressure.

Bryce Underwood's Development:: Underwood is noted as being advanced for his age with high football knowledge, impressing the coaching staff with his dedication to learning the playbook.

Offensive Line Depth:: The team aims to solidify a group of 8-9 players who can rotate effectively, ensuring minimal disruption if a player is lost.

Kicker Impact:: Dominic Zvada's impressive field goal range is recognized as a significant asset, influencing strategic decisions during games.

Chip Lindsey's press conference shed light on several key aspects of Michigan's offensive strategy and player development. The quarterback competition is a central focus, with Lindsey emphasizing the importance of evaluating players under pressure and in various game situations. The addition of Jake Garcia brings experience to the room, complementing the existing talents of Underwood, Keene, and Davis.

Lindsey also addressed the wide receiver corps, highlighting the need for improvement and increased competition. The coaching staff is working to identify each player's strengths and leverage those skills effectively. The development of young talents like Jacob Washington and Ty Haywood is also a positive sign for the team's future.
